Europe
Portugal may withdraw troops from Iraq
2004-04-16
Portugal may withdraw its national guard contingent from Iraq if the security situation in the country continues to deteriorate, Interior Minister Antonio Figueiredo Lopes said on Friday. “If the conflict were to deteriorate and the GNR (national guard) did not have what it required to carry out its mission, the only solution would be to withdraw,” he told Antena 1 public radio. Portugal in November dispatched 128 national guards to southern Iraq to back the US-led coalition in the war-torn country, where they operate under British command.
